Tax Law
Tax law refers to the legal rules and regulations governing the taxation process, including the assessment, collection, and enforcement of taxes. It encompasses a wide range of issues related to income tax, corporate tax, sales tax, property tax, and other forms of taxation, both at the federal and state levels. Tax law is designed to establish how taxes are imposed and collected, the obligations of taxpayers, and the rights of taxpayers in relation to tax authorities. It also includes provisions for tax deductions, credits, and exemptions, as well as guidelines for tax compliance and the consequences of tax evasion. Tax law is an important area of legal practice, often involving intricate regulations and administrative procedures that lawyers and accountants navigate to assist individuals and businesses in complying with tax obligations while optimizing their tax liabilities.
